SPORTING.
Lower Valley Jockey Club. A meeting of the Stewards was hold at Martinborongh on Saturday niylit, when tlio programme was drawn up, subject, to the approval af tho Mctrotfjten Club, 1. li(3Rip Hurdle Race, of 40aovs; second 1 liurso 10 sovs from stakes nomination 1 sow, acceptance 1 sov. Two miles, over eight flights of darkened hurdles, 3ft Bin high, 2. Hack Hurdle linco, of 15 sovs;one milo and a half, ovor six flights of darkened hurdles, 3ft 9in high; minimum weight lOst; post entry IDs. 8. Flying Handicap of 25 sovs; 0 furlongs. Nomination 10s, acceptance 10a. 4. Maiden Hack llaco, of 10 sovs: one mile; catch weights; post entry lUi. fl, L.V.J.O. Handicap of 50 suvs; second horso 5 sovs from the stakes; two miles; nomination 1 sov; acceptance lsov, and 10s at post.
6. Hack Raco of 15 sovs; one mile: minimum weight 10at; post entry jfis. 7. Maitinborougli Handicap, of 20 sovs; one inile; nomination 10s; acceptances.
